I also started the Oculus app on my PC before sending “Send to VR on Oculus Quest” via the Sketch VR extension menu in SketchUp as that is what fixes the errors with SketchUp Viewer (So not sure that is necessary with VR Sketch). I attempted to “send to VR on this PC” before installing the Oculus Quest 2 app and this did not work (SteamVR error finding headset). Once the VR Sketch for PC extension is installed into SketchUp, you need to install the VR Sketch app from the Meta app store ( ). The extension manager actually says, “Install Extension” not “Install”. One says to click on “Window” rather than “Extensions” in SketchUp (apparently correct for SketchUp Make 2017).
